A126478 Number of base 10 n-digit numbers with adjacent digits differing by three or less. 2
1, 10, 58, 350, 2130, 12990, 79258, 483646, 2951370, 18010366, 109906170, 670689902, 4092809194, 24975905246, 152412637946, 930080892110, 5675713495690, 34635399953406, 211358612597658, 1289792038765742 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)

COMMENTS
[Empirical] a(base,n)=a(base-1,n)+7^(n-1) for base>=3n-2; a(base,n)=a(base-1,n)+7^(n-1)-2 when base=3n-3
LINKS
FORMULA
Conjectures from Colin Barker, May 31 2017: (Start)
G.f.: (1 + 3*x - 8*x^2 - 6*x^3 + 6*x^4) / (1 - 7*x + 4*x^2 + 10*x^3 - 6*x^4).
a(n) = 7*a(n-1) - 4*a(n-2) - 10*a(n-3) + 6*a(n-4) for n>4.
(End)
